#2b2836 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2b2836 is composed of 16.9% red, 15.7% green and 21.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 20.4% cyan, 25.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 78.8% black. It has a hue angle of 252.9 degrees, a saturation of 14.9% and a lightness of 18.4%. #2b2836 color hex could be obtained by blending #56506c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

● #2b2836 color description : Very dark grayish blue.
#2b2836 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2b2836 has RGB values of R:43, G:40, B:54 and CMYK values of C:0.2, M:0.26, Y:0, K:0.79. Its decimal value is 2828342.
